County begins free valley wide transit service
Valley County Connections travels between Cascade and McCall, Donnelly and Tamarack
TECLA MARKOSKY | July 19, 2007
THE STAR NEWS

A free commuter bus connecting McCall, Donnelly, Lake Fork, Tamarack Resort and Cascade began operations last week. Valley County Connections is a joint project between the Idaho Transportation Department, McCall Transit, Tamarack Municipal Association, Valley Adams Planning Partnership, and the cities of McCall, Donnelly and Cascade.

It was two years in the making.

Dick Carter, mayor of Cascade, described the planning process as a "two year odyssey."
The funding for the service is provided by a Federal Transit Association rural transportation grant that was awarded through the Idaho Transportation Department to McCall Transit and was given matching contributions from Tamarack Resort and Treasure Valley Transit.

Cost for the first year of service was estimated at $200,000. Valley County Commissioner Frank Eld was triumphant during the ceremony preceding the first ride.

"This is a big day for Valley County. We are connected! This just proves that communities can make things happen," he said. Tamarack representatives believe the buses will aide in the growth of the valley. Equipped with bike and ski racks, outdoor enthusiasts will have no trouble using the service.

"It is inevitable that our region will continue to gain greater recognition as a prime national destination," said Jim Spenst, vice president of operations for Tamarack.

Carter said he has already noticed excitement in the community over the new bus.

"This project has generated a great deal of excitement from the senior center," he said. "It's a great example of what can happen if we all get in the harness and pull in the same direction."

Donnelly Mayor George Dorris said he looks forward to seeing less of a strain on workers' pocketbooks in the time of ever increasing gas prices.

"If we can get our worker bees going back and forth in the morning, it will be nice for them," he said.

Pickup and drop-off points in McCall will be McCall City Hall and Ridley's Family Market. There will also be a stop in Lake Fork.

In the Donnelly/Tamarack area, the bus will stop at West Roseberry Plaza, The Meadows at West Mountain subdivision and Crane Creek Market at the resort.

In Cascade, stops will be at Harpo's Chevron and The Ashley Inn.

Buses leave McCall City Hall and Harpo's at 6:15 a.m. each day and complete the trip across the valley in about an hour.

Other departure times from McCall are 7:15 a.m.. 8:15 a.m. and 10:15 a.m.
Afternoon trips from McCall leave at 2:15 p.m., 4:15 p.m. and 5:15 p.m., while afternoon trips from Cascade leave at 3:15 p.m., 4:15 p.m. and 5:15 p.m.
Shuttle service between Tamarack and Donnelly begins at 6:40 a.m.
